Plastic Parts: Which are the best wear resistant plastics?22nd January 2012, 19:22 Plastic Parts: Which are the best wear resistant plastics? Partwell engineering plastics can offer outstanding wear and abrasion resistance. Ultra High Molecular Weight Polyethylene 1000 grade or UHMWPE is the toughest grade of Polyethylene, not only does it provide wear and abrasion resistance but also elongation and coefficient friction. PE1000 grade is perfect for high wear applications, often the material of choice in the conveyor, canning and bottling plants as wear parts and belts. Nylon plastic sheet also offers good wear and abrasion resistance. Nylon is a stiff material with good coefficient of friction. Often machined in to machine guards and guides. Both UHMWPE 1000 grade and nylon can be supplied as full or part sheets and CNC engineered into bespoke plastic parts and components.
